Vue 是一個(gè)流行的 JavaScript 框架,由尤雨溪 (Evan You) 在 2014 年創(chuàng)立。它以 MVVM 模式為基礎(chǔ),提供一組簡(jiǎn)單易用的 API 和優(yōu)雅的語(yǔ)法,使得開(kāi)發(fā)者可以快速構(gòu)建高效、靈活的單頁(yè)應(yīng)用 (Single Page Applications,縮寫(xiě) SPA)。
2016 年是 Vue 發(fā)展的重要一年。當(dāng)年發(fā)布的 Vue 2.0 版本,是一個(gè)重大的升級(jí)。它帶來(lái)了一系列重要的變化和改進(jìn),包括:
? 性能提升:虛擬 DOM 和渲染優(yōu)化使得 Vue 2.0 比 1.x 更快、更輕量;
? 更好的 TypeScript 支持:Vue 提供了完整的類型聲明文件,讓使用 TypeScript 開(kāi)發(fā)更加舒適;
? 漸進(jìn)式框架:Vue 2.0 是一個(gè)漸進(jìn)式框架,允許按需引入組件和功能,以更好地滿足用戶需求;
? 更好的組件復(fù)用:Vue 2.0 引入了動(dòng)態(tài)組件和異步組件,使得復(fù)用組件變得更加容易。
總之,Vue 2.0 為開(kāi)發(fā)人員提供了更好的開(kāi)發(fā)體驗(yàn)和更好的性能,使得 Vue 成為了一種非常受歡迎的前端框架。